What does a Film Assistant do?
As a film assistant, you work to assist in film productions, primarily behind the camera. The tasks can vary greatly depending on the size and budget of the production. Common tasks include handling equipment, assisting with lighting and sound technology, and sometimes participating in set design and props. The work environment can be both indoors in a studio and outdoors, which can present both physical and mental challenges depending on the weather and filming conditions.
Film Assistant salary
According to our survey, the average salary for a film assistant is 35 500 SEK per month. Men earn an average of 35 300 SEK while women earn an average of 36 500 SEK, which means that women earn about 103% of what men earn in the profession. Hourly employees as film assistants have an average hourly wage of 213 SEK.
Salary development and differences
Compared to last year, the average salary has increased from 35 100 SEK to 35 500 SEK, indicating some salary development within the profession. The highest salary for a film assistant is 42,500 SEK, while the lowest is 33,200 SEK. These salaries apply within the private sector and vary depending on education level.
Education and qualifications
To become a film assistant, it is common to have a secondary education, preferably with a focus on media or technology. Post-secondary education in film production or technical theater can also be an advantage. Practical experience and technical skills are highly valued.
Common benefits
Benefits may include a company mobile phone and sometimes opportunities for professional development. Remote work is, however, rare due to the nature of the tasks.
Future prospects and demand
The Employment Agency does not make a specific assessment for film assistants due to limited data. The profession falls under the category of lighting, sound, and stage technicians, where demand can vary depending on projects and productions.
Tips for those who want to become Film Assistants
To succeed as a film assistant, it is important to stay updated with the latest technology in film production. Build a network in the industry to gain more job opportunities and consider specializing in a specific area such as lighting or sound to increase your attractiveness in the job market.
Career paths
With experience, a film assistant can advance to roles such as lighting or sound technician, or even production manager. Opportunities for career development are good within the film and media industry for those who wish to take on more responsibility and specialize.
What positively affects the salary?
Factors that can positively affect the salary include further education, long experience, increased responsibility, and specialization in specific technical areas. Working in larger productions or within the private sector can also lead to higher salaries.

About the data
All information displayed on this page is based on data from the Swedish Central Bureau of Statistics (SCB), the Swedish Tax Agency and the Swedish employment agency. Learn more about our data and data sources here.
All figures are gross salaries, meaning salaries before tax. The average salary, or mean salary, is calculated by adding up the total salary for all individuals within the profession and dividing it by the number of individuals. For specific job categories, we have also considered various criteria such as experience and education.
Profession Film passers-by has the SSYK code 3522, which we use to match against the SCB database to obtain the latest salary statistics.
